Rui Cao is a scholar working on Biomedical Engineering, Radiology, Nuclear Medicine and Imaging and Molecular Biology. According to data from OpenAlex, Rui Cao has authored 72 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Biomedical Engineering, 18 papers in Radiology, Nuclear Medicine and Imaging and 13 papers in Molecular Biology. Recurrent topics in Rui Cao's work include Photoacoustic and Ultrasonic Imaging (30 papers), Optical Imaging and Spectroscopy Techniques (17 papers) and Thermography and Photoacoustic Techniques (11 papers). Rui Cao is often cited by papers focused on Photoacoustic and Ultrasonic Imaging (30 papers), Optical Imaging and Spectroscopy Techniques (17 papers) and Thermography and Photoacoustic Techniques (11 papers). Rui Cao collaborates with scholars based in United States, China and Hong Kong. Rui Cao's co-authors include Song Hu, Bo Ning, Naidi Sun, Lihong V. Wang, Qifa Zhou, Tianxiong Wang, John A. Hossack, Zhiyi Zuo, Yide Zhang and Ruimin Chen and has published in prestigious journals such as Nature Communications, The EMBO Journal and Applied Physics Letters.
